> In shell, we have custom formatter to convert from bytes to Long/Int for
> long/int data type values.
> Many times we store the epoch timestamp (event creation, updation time) as
> long in our table columns. Even after converting this column to Long, the
> date is not in a human readable format. We still have to convert this long
> into date using some bash shell tricks and it is not convenient to do for
> many columns. We can introduce a new format method called +toLongDate+ which
> signifies that we want to convert the bytes to long first and then to date.
> Please let me know if any such functionality already exists and I am not
> aware of.
